Xenoblade Chronicles - Would I like this game if I really like Kingdom Hearts and Final Fantasy? Is it good visually and music wise (strange question, I know)
Depends on which Final Fantasy you compare it to, it's a lot like FFXII but better. Xenoblade is visually impressive in it's way. It's very colorful, sports loads of textures, new armor changes your appearance, and it has massive areas. Plus you won't see a loading screen every fifteen steps, like you would in Monster Hunter Tri. It's not all wonderful though--you'll see lots of polygon pop up in denser areas, like Makna Forest. The character models don't look like they were motion captured leading to some very goofy looking running and jumping animations, and faces could be more expressive. I can't find anything I dislike about the music though. It's phenomenal. Nintendo Power said some of the composers who worked on Kingdom Hearts helped make the 90 pieces of music that make up Xenoblade. Pretty impressive stuff.
